Brake Abs Warning Light problems of the 2008 Chrysler 300

Failure Date: 01/01/2014

The contact owns a 2008 Chrysler 300. The contact stated that the vehicle failed to start. The vehicle was taken to the dealer. The technician diagnosed that the module transmitters needed to be replaced. The vehicle was repaired; however, the failure recurred. In addition, the contact stated that the vehicle was jerking and the abs warning light illuminated. The vehicle was taken to a dealer where it was diagnosed that the abs module needed to be reset. The vehicle was repaired. The manufacturer was notified of the failure and stated that the VIN was included in NHTSA campaign number: 14v567000 (electrical system). The failure mileage was 140,000.
